#1875ff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1875ff is composed of 9.4% red, 45.9%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.6% cyan, 54.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 215.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 54.7%. #1875ff color hex could be obtained by blending #30eaff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

Shades and Tints of #1875ff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#f0f6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1875ff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838a94 is the less saturated color, while #1875ff is the most saturated one.
